Let's analyze the statement step-by-step: Anup recalls:
“He is the son of the father of my daughter’s mother.” Break it down:
- My daughter’s mother :
- The mother of Anup's daughter is Anup's wife (assuming traditional family roles).
- The father of my daughter’s mother :
- The father of Anup's wife, i.e., Anup's father-in-law.
- He is the son of the father of my daughter’s mother :
- "He" (Sandeep) is the son of Anup's father-in-law.
Since Anup's father-in-law is the father of Anup's wife, his son would be
Anup's wife's brother. Conclusion:
Sandeep is Anup's brother-in-law.
Final answer:
Sandeep is Anup’s brother-in-law.
